Sky Bet League 2: Matchday 25 preview

31 December 2015

Battles at both ends of Sky Bet League 2 are finely poised as the season moves into the New Year.

Plymouth Argyle lead the way going in to 2016, and they will make the unusual trip to Ewood Park for their first game of the New Year, to take on Carlisle United, while four of the bottom five lock horns in Matchday 25.

With Carlisle's Brunton Park still unplayable after the floods in Cumbria, Ewood Park is the latest destination for a home fixture, where they take on table-topping Plymouth.

The Cumbrians are going well in League 2 themselves, sitting seventh with two games-in-hand on the majority of teams above them, and this promises to be a cracker.

Northampton are Plymouth's nearest challengers, and they host Barnet at Sixfields.

Things are tight at the other end of the table too, with six points separating the bottom five clubs. Four of those meet this weekend - Yeovil Town host York City, while Newport County welcome Hartlepool United.

The other team in that pack are Dagenham & Redbridge - one of four clubs who begin 2016 without a permanent manager at the helm.

The aforementioned Yeovil are another of those sides, the other two are Luton - who go to in-form Bristol Rovers - and Notts County, who departed with Ricardo Moniz earlier this week. The Magpies face off against third-placed Oxford.

Elsewhere, Play-Off chasing Portsmouth and Wycombe have home fixtures against sides in the bottom half, Leyton Orient and Wimbledon are on the road at Stevenage and Cambridge respectively, and Mansfield host Accrington Stanley.
